MINSK, 10 December (BelTA) – Negotiations of Deputy Prime Minister of Belarus Igor Lyashenko and Russian Deputy Prime Minister Dmitry Kozak will take place in Moscow on 11 December, the press service of the Belarusian government told BelTA.
BelTA reported earlier that the sides intend to discuss the compensation for the losses the Belarusian economy has incurred due to the adjusted taxation of the Russian oil industry. An algorithm for compensations for Belarus is supposed to be worked out by 15 December.
